The Tale in the Minish Cap follows Link, the courageous younger hero, as he embarks on a quest to avoid wasting Princess Zelda and also the kingdom of Hyrule with the evil sorcerer Vaati. Vaati shatters the sacred Picori Blade, leading to chaos during the land, and turns Zelda to stone in his pursuit of electricity. To revive the blade and defeat Vaati, Hyperlink is supplied the Minish Cap, a magical artifact that allows him to shrink to the dimensions of the Minish, a small and mystical race of creatures. This new skill is at the heart of the game’s exclusive mechanics, offering players the possibility to take a look at the planet of Hyrule from a contemporary standpoint.
The core gameplay from the Minish Cap stays rooted in the standard Zelda components—dungeon exploration, item collection, and puzzle-solving. Even so, the shrinking mechanic introduces a completely new dimension to your experience. When Hyperlink shrinks, he gains entry to hidden regions and might clear up puzzles that may if not be impossible. The planet close to him adjustments substantially: smaller gaps develop into satisfactory, seemingly insignificant objects turn into hurdles to overcome, and bigger-than-everyday living enemies surface extra scary than in the past. This continual shift in standpoint retains the gameplay sensation new and thrilling.
As Link embarks on his journey, he encounters many goods, like the boomerang, bombs, and also the innovative Gust Jar, which will allow him to blow air to move obstacles or defeat enemies. The Picori Blade performs a central function in the plot, strengthening as Backlink progresses by way of his journey. With Every dungeon, gamers obtain new applications that open up further exploration and battle choices, all though using the shrinking mechanic to find out hidden techniques and resolve puzzles.
